Unpaginated. ca 300pp. Very similar to the British Humber Mk.IV armoured car, the Fox was manufactured by General Motors of Canada. It was armed with a .50 and .30 cal machine gun in a hand-cranked turret. It saw limited duty in the Italian theatre, reconnaissance and escort units in northern Europe opted for M3A3 Stuarts, as well as Staghound and Daimler armoured cars. 1506 Foxes were manufactured in total. This manual covers every detail of the vehicle, and includes stowage diagrams. Document originally published in 1942. Scarce.
